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
71957793 559 21551664
14908973 746464873 1897883
14908973 746464873 1897883
200 53496057 5408103
All about undefined
Interested in learning more?
14908973 746464873 1897883
200 53496057 5408103
See more
270381713 71997
4786 125123 21647
See more
939593 6346802875
7155997304 476077 24 1902680
See more